#52a96c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#52a96c is composed of 32.2% red, 66.3%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.1%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 137.9 degrees, a saturation of 34.7% and a lightness of 49.2%. #52a96c color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ffd8 with #005300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#52a96c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b07 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#52a96c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#79827c is the less saturated color, while #05f64d is the most saturated one.
